Subject: [PATCH 00/11] arm64: tegra: Add NVIDIA Jetson AGX Orin support

This set of patches adds support for the new NVIDIA Jetson AGX Orin
module and the corresponding developer kit. It builds on the existing
Tegra234 support introduced a while ago for the simulation VDK platform
and updates a couple of details and adds a few more things that have
changed since then.

Most of this work was done by Mikko Perttunen.

Thierry

Mikko Perttunen (7):
  dt-bindings: Update headers for Tegra234
  misc: sram: Add compatible string for Tegra234 SYSRAM
  arm64: tegra: Add clock for Tegra234 RTC
  arm64: tegra: Update Tegra234 BPMP channel addresses
  arm64: tegra: Fill in properties for Tegra234 eMMC
  arm64: tegra: Add Tegra234 TCU device
  arm64: tegra: Add NVIDIA Jetson AGX Orin Developer Kit support

Thierry Reding (4):
  dt-bindings: tegra: Describe recent developer kits consistently
  dt-bindings: tegra: Document Jetson AGX Orin (and devkit)
  dt-bindings: sram: Document NVIDIA Tegra SYSRAM
  arm64: tegra: Fixup SYSRAM references
